Terraria v1.4.4.9
Terraria source code documentation
|
Public Member Functions | |
void | OnCompleted (Action continuation) |
void | UnsafeOnCompleted (Action continuation) |
void | GetResult () |
void | OnCompleted (Action continuation) |
void | UnsafeOnCompleted (Action continuation) |
TResult | GetResult () |
Package Functions | |
TaskAwaiter (Task task) | |
TaskAwaiter (Task< TResult > task) | |
Static Package Functions | |
static void | ValidateEnd (Task task) |
static void | OnCompletedInternal (Task task, Action continuation, bool continueOnCapturedContext, bool flowExecutionContext) |
static void | UnsafeOnCompletedInternal (Task task, IAsyncStateMachineBox stateMachineBox, bool continueOnCapturedContext) |
Package Attributes | |
readonly Task | m_task |
Properties | |
bool | IsCompleted [get] |
Static Private Member Functions | |
static void | HandleNonSuccessAndDebuggerNotification (Task task) |
static void | ThrowForNonSuccess (Task task) |
static Action | OutputWaitEtwEvents (Task task, Action continuation) |
Private Attributes | |
readonly Task< TResult > | m_task |
Definition at line 149 of file TaskAwaiter.cs.